O formato CDG (também chamado de CD+G ou MP3+G) é adequado para a maioria das maquinas de karaokê. Ele inclui um arquivo MP3 e a sincronização das letras.

É possível reproduzir arquivos mp4 num Mac OS X e Windows 7 por definição. Caso você use Windows XP ou Vista, voce precisa ter o Windows Media Player 12.

O programa KaraFun Windows Player lê esse formato, você pode baixar grátis. Esse eficiente formato pode armazenar múltiplas trilhas de audio adicionais e um fundo que se movimenta no ritmo da música.

Com coros (com ou sem vozes na versão KFN)

Tempo: variável (aproximadamente 76 BPM)

Tonalidade idêntica ao original: Ré

Duração: 03:14 - Visualizar: 01:32

Ano de lançamento: 2020
Estilos: Country, Em inglês
Autor Original: Randy Montana, Riley Green, Erik Dylan Anderson
